4 Things to Consider Before Pushing a Pharmaceutical Lawsuit
Generic drugs are the most commonly used drugs accounting for over 80% of all drugs used in most medical facilities. These drugs are preferred for their affordability, as they do not require many resources to produce compared to all alternative methods. There is however, the issue of what to do in case the drugs backfire. It is possible that you will have to take legal action when this happens. Below are some of the things you must be mindful before pushing a pharmaceutical lawsuit.
Understand if you have any chance to sue
A doctor may have played his or her role of treatment and drug prescription properly. However, when purchasing the drugs a pharmacy could be ignorant enough to give you the wrong drug triggering an adverse reaction and sometimes death. If this is the case, then you have all the necessary grounds to sue or make claim against the pharmacy as this type of cases are not limited to manufacturer's mistakes.
Cost of suing a pharmaceutical company
Pharmaceutical claims are complex and as such involve investing long periods translating to significant cost implications. Find out how the attorney you choose operates as you may make major saves especially if he or she wants to be paid after recovery of claim. You should contact a reputable law firm only when you think you stand a chance against the drug company you intended to sue.

Limitations to the lawsuit
All laws have a duration within which to file a case that is considered viable. Pharmaceutical cases, may it be about a zofran cleft lip problem, are no different. Understand the necessary legal statutes of limitations in your state before suing. Filing a case when there is no time to do so only leads to wastage as nothing will be done. To further increase the chances of the case succeeding then you must find out what requirements are necessary to sue.
